public string GetAllContent() { JSonResult result = new JSonResult(); result.Status = false; List<GetContent> allContent = new List<GetContent>(); Content content = new Content(); DataSet ds = content.GetAllContent(); foreach (DataRow dr in ds.Tables[0].Rows) { GetContent eachContent = new GetContent(); eachContent.ContentId = dr["ContentId"].ToString(); eachContent.ContentName = dr["ContentName"].ToString(); eachContent.ReferenceContentId = dr["ReferenceContentId"].ToString(); string masterContentName; content.GetContentName(Convert.ToInt32(dr["ReferenceContentId"]), out masterContentName); eachContent.MasterContentName = masterContentName; eachContent.ContentType = dr["ContentType"].ToString(); allContent.Add(eachContent); } result.Status = true; JavaScriptSerializer serializer = new JavaScriptSerializer(); string jsonresult = serializer.Serialize(allContent); return jsonresult; }
public string CreateNewContent(string contentName, string masterContentName) { JSonResult result = new JSonResult(); result.Status = false; Content content = new Content(); result.Status = content.CreateNewContent(contentName, masterContentName); JavaScriptSerializer serializer = new JavaScriptSerializer(); string jsonresult = serializer.Serialize(result.Status); return jsonresult; }
public string Saveposition(string contentName, int x, int y, int width, int height) { JSonResult result = new JSonResult(); result.Status = false; Content cont = new Content(); cont.UpdateContentPosition(contentName, x + "_" + y + "_" + width + "_" + height); result.Status = true; JavaScriptSerializer serializer = new JavaScriptSerializer(); string jsonresult = serializer.Serialize(result.Status); return jsonresult; }
public string GetContentPosition(string contentName) { JSonResult result = new JSonResult(); result.Status = false; Content cont = new Content(); DataSet ds = cont.GetContentPosition(contentName); string position = ""; List<GetContent> allContent = new List<GetContent>(); foreach (DataRow dr in ds.Tables[0].Rows){ GetContent eachContent = new GetContent(); eachContent.Position = dr["Position"].ToString(); eachContent.Image = dr["Image"].ToString(); allContent.Add(eachContent); } result.Status = true; JavaScriptSerializer serializer = new JavaScriptSerializer(); string jsonresult = serializer.Serialize(allContent); return jsonresult; }